Kirkland Signature Vitamin D3
Winter is approaching, and for many of us, it’s a time when we’re more likely to fall short in vitamin D. Our bodies produce vitamin D when our skin is exposed to sunlight, but with shorter days and reduced UVB rays, it’s essential to supplement our diet with vitamin D. Fatty fish, mushrooms, and egg yolks are some of the few foods that naturally contain vitamin D, but it’s often difficult to get enough through diet alone.
Kirkland Signature Vitamin D3 is a popular supplement that’s on sale at Costco. These softgels are third-party tested and receive the USP mark, ensuring the quality is top-notch. With no yeast, starch, or gluten, and free of artificial colors and flavors, these softgels are an excellent choice for those looking to supplement their vitamin D intake.
Kirkland Signature Vitamin C
Vitamin C is an essential nutrient that supports the immune system, healthy gut, skin, and brain. While citrus fruits like oranges and grapefruit are well-known sources of vitamin C, there are many other foods that are rich in this nutrient, including broccoli, kiwi, bell peppers, guava, pineapple, and papaya.
Kirkland Signature Vitamin C is a supplement that’s designed to provide a boost of vitamin C to your diet. These tablets are gluten-free, yeast-free, and soy-free, with no artificial flavors, colors, or preservatives. With USP verification, you can trust that you’re getting a high-quality supplement that meets your needs.
Nature Made Prenatal Folic Acid + DHA
Whether you’re expecting or trying to conceive, nutrition is crucial for the healthy development of your baby. Folic acid is a B vitamin that helps prevent life-threatening birth defects, including those to the neural tube. With a recommended daily intake of 600 micrograms, it’s essential to ensure you’re getting enough folic acid through your diet or supplements.
Nature Made Prenatal Folic Acid + DHA is a supplement that’s designed to support the health of your baby. These softgels provide a range of essential vitamins and minerals, as well as omega-3 fatty acids in the form of DHA and EPA. With USP verification and gluten-free ingredients, these softgels are an excellent choice for pregnant women or those trying to conceive.
Nature’s Bounty Odorless Fish Oil
Regularly eating fatty fish can provide essential omega-3 fatty acids, which have been shown to reduce inflammation and heart disease, and support a healthy brain. However, it can be difficult to get enough seafood in your diet, whether due to taste, allergies, or budget constraints.
Nature’s Bounty Odorless Fish Oil is a supplement that’s designed to provide a convenient and odorless way to get your omega-3s. These coated softgels are USP verified and provide 1400 mg of omega-3s per serving. With no fishy aftertaste or burps, these softgels are an excellent choice for those who want to supplement their omega-3 intake without the hassle of fishy side effects.
